The beige palette, a central theme in this collaboration, is far from mundane. It’s not the beige of beige paint on a wall; instead, it’s a sophisticated, nuanced beige, ranging from creamy off-whites to warm, sandy tones. This subtle variation within the beige spectrum reflects Jacquemus's signature approach to color – a restrained elegance that elevates the simplicity of the palette. This careful consideration of color speaks volumes about the collaboration's overall ethos: a subtle yet powerful statement of understated luxury. The beige is not merely a backdrop; it's a character in itself, shaping the overall mood and aesthetic of the collection.
